Don't worry; there are some practical steps you can take to fix this: 1. **Get in Touch with Apple Support:** Reach out to Apple's support team – they're like the superheroes of tech problems. Explain what happened and give them your correct email. They'll work their magic to sort things out. 2. **Check Your Account Settings:** If you still have access to the wrong email, see if you can change your email linked to your Apple ID. It's like updating your contact info; it just might do the trick. 3. **Try to Recover the Wrong Email:** If that wrong email is yours, maybe you can recover it. It's like digging up your lost keys. Once you have it back, you can make things right. 4. **Consider a Fresh Start:** As a last resort, you could create a new Apple ID with the correct email. It's like moving to a new house – you'll have to pack up your music collection, but at least it's a fresh beginning. Just hang in there and be patient. Apple's support team is there to help, and soon enough, you'll be back to enjoying your tunes hassle-free. These are some of the solutions I’ve seen work from personal experience!
